A Study of Whether Ide-cel (bb2121) Can Be Made From People With Multiple Myeloma Who Have Had a Hematopoietic Cell Transplant

Running, not enrolling · Phase 2

Conditions studied: Multiple Myeloma

In brief

The purpose of this study is to see if the quality of T cells used to create ide-cel (bb2121) affects how ide-cel prevents cancer from coming back in people with relapsed or refractory multiple myeloma (MM), and who have had a hematopoietic cell transplant.
